Hooked up with the same tour group -- and all the same travelers -- from yesterday for the 3 hour drive to Punta Tombo to see the Magellenic penguins. This colony lives at sea most of the year, migrating to Brazilian waters in the austral winter following anchovies and squid (who wouldn't?!?!), then return here to breed.
